Feasibility of a low-power, low-voltage complementary organic thin film transistor buskeeper physical unclonable function

摘要

This paper demonstrates an implementation of physical unclonable function (PUF) using complementary organic transistors operating at low-voltage. PUF is an essential security element, and is important for various applications of organic devices. We implement a simple buskeeper PUF, which consists of two inverters. We confirm that the PUF bit values on the test chip can be read at a standard voltage for electronic circuits (3.3 V) via a standardized circuit board interface. We observed a low static current consumption (11.8 mu A/90 bits) for the PUF chip. The PUF performance, chip-to-board interface performance, and requirements for the board interface in an organic transistor chip are discussed based on the measurement results of the test chip.
